Hot water seals voltage variation test at 100°C × 22h, only below 25% qualify—normal temperature data doubles immediately after hot water enters. Water heater seals determine the temperature level of the seal.

After installing the sealing ring for half a year, it softened and deformed under pressure in hot water, causing the faucet to start dripping—material with excessive pressure changes can pass short-term testing, but will collapse over time.

Dripping doesn't leak overnight; it gradually wears away from pressure changes.

SEBS base is the "gentle type"—soft and glutinous at room temperature and water-resistant; TPV is the "heat-resistant substitute," able to withstand 100°C hot water. When water temperature exceeds 80°C, if the gentle type isn't enough, use a substitute. Soak in hot water all year round, if SEBS isn't enough, switch to TPV.

Don't just do short-term heat resistance tests—soak continuously for 1000 hours at actual water temperature, then test pressure change and rebound at maturity. If the test cycle isn't enough, it's as if there was no test at all. The acceptance cycle should follow the service life

The gasket becoming soft and sticky is not due to poor material — it's because the oil-filled system migrates at high temperatures, with low molecular components moving to the surface. Stickiness, exudation, and increased compression all stem from insufficient temperature resistance.

If it becomes sticky in hot water, first check the oil filling level, then check the system's temperature resistance.

For water heater seals, if the long-term working temperature is above 80℃, choose TPV or silicone; SEBS-based ones are too hard. SEBS-based materials permanently deform faster above 80℃, and the seal will loosen after three months — temperature resistance level affects lifespan more than hardness.

The heater seal's temperature resistance is accepted if the compression set after 90℃×168h is ≤25%. After long-term soaking in hot water, the compression set of SEBS rises quickly, while TPV or silicone seals maintain a more stable compression set—choose the temperature resistance rating based on the actual water temperature, not room temperature data for mass production.

The compression amount for installing the water heater seal is designed at 20%-25%. Too loose causes leaks, too tight accelerates aging. The compression amount is the switch for the seal's lifespan—calculate the compression properly before placing an order, don’t just measure the inner diameter and produce in bulk.
